  • Continuing the Official snicks Top 100 Lost Hits of The 80's ... And here we are. The Ten Greatest Lost Hits of The 80's! At Number Three is ... "I Couldn't Say No" by Robert Ellis Orrall & Carlene Carter

  • And here we have my favorite duet of the 80's, with singer/songwriter Robert Ellis Orrall and the faboo Carlene Carter. Maybe it's my favorite because it looked like my elementary school music teacher singing with the hot hippie chick who lived down the street and would occasionally babysit. It peaked at #32 in May of 1983, and is completely undeserving of its forgotten status. Here's the clue for #2 - "Is It The Love Of The Danger, Or The Danger Of The Love?"
